Benefits of Planetary Gearboxes

High Torque Density

Planetary gearboxes have a very high torque density compared to other types of gearboxes. This means that they can transmit a high level of torque for their physical size. This makes them particularly well-suited for use in applications where space is limited, such as in electric vehicles or robotics.

High Efficiency

Planetary gearboxes are also very efficient, with efficiency levels of up to 98%. This means that very little power is lost as heat, making them ideal for use in applications where energy efficiency is important, such as in wind turbines or industrial machinery.

High Precision

Planetary gearboxes are very precise, with low backlash and high stiffness. This means that they can maintain accurate positioning even under heavy loads, making them ideal for use in robotic arms or CNC machines.

Quiet Operation

Planetary gearboxes are also very quiet in operation, due to the even distribution of forces across multiple planetary gears. This makes them ideal for use in applications where noise levels need to be kept to a minimum, such as in medical equipment or audiovisual systems.

Low Maintenance

Finally, planetary gearboxes require very little maintenance, due to their compact design and minimal number of moving parts. This makes them ideal for use in remote or hard-to-reach locations, such as in offshore wind turbines or mining equipment.

How Planetary Gearboxes Work

Planetary gearboxes consist of three main components: a sun gear, planet gears, and a ring gear. The planet gears are arranged around the sun gear in a circular pattern, and are held in place by a carrier. The ring gear surrounds the planet gears, and meshes with them to transmit torque.

When the sun gear rotates, it causes the planet gears to rotate around it. This in turn causes the carrier to rotate, which meshes the planet gears with the ring gear, transmitting torque to the output shaft.

Choosing the Right Planetary Gearbox

Choosing the right planetary gearbox for your application can be a complex process, but it is important to get it right to ensure optimal performance and efficiency. Here are some key factors to consider:

Ratio

The gear ratio determines the relationship between the input and output speed and torque. It is important to select a gearbox with the right gear ratio to match your application’s requirements.

Input Speed

Planetary gearboxes have a maximum input speed, beyond which they may experience overheating or damage. It is important to select a gearbox with an input speed rating that matches your application’s requirements.

Output Torque

The output torque is determined by the gear ratio and the input torque. It is important to select a gearbox with a high enough output torque to handle your application’s requirements.

Operating Environment

The operating environment can have a significant impact on the performance and lifespan of a planetary gearbox. Factors such as temperature, humidity, and exposure to dust or corrosive materials should be taken into account when selecting a gearbox.

Mounting Options

Planetary gearboxes can be mounted in a variety of ways, depending on the application requirements. It is important to select a gearbox with the right mounting options to ensure a secure and stable installation.
